Add 20/8 and 35/3
1st number: 2 4/8, 2nd number: 11 2/3
20/8 + 35/3 is 85/6.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 3 is 24
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 24 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 3 = 24,
20/8 = 20 × 3/8 × 3 = 60/24 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 3 × 8 = 24,
35/3 = 35 × 8/3 × 8 = 280/24 - Add the two like fractions:
60/24 + 280/24 = 60 + 280/24 = 340/24 - 340/24 simplified gives 85/6
- So, 20/8 + 35/3 = 85/6
